Errori, bug, domande - pagina 1363

 
Alexey Navoykov:

Per prima cosa, fate almeno un esempio di come l'introduzione di * o & può influenzare i codici esistenti, poi avrete un esempio di cui parlare.

Non posso fare esempi perché non ci sono operazioni * e & e la loro priorità non è definita.
 
Alexey Navoykov:

Beh, se non puoi vederli, non significa che non esistano, è stato tutto discusso.

Da ciò che è stato discusso, ho solo capito che sei infastidito da a.operator==(b) mentre di solito è combinato con if (o ?:) ed è molto raramente parte di qualsiasi espressione complessa
 

Non riesco a capire perché l'EA non parte nel tester; apre la finestra di test in modalità visualizzazione e poi la chiude. Sto incollando uno screenshot del messaggio nel diario. L'EA compila senza errori, ma viene scaricato immediatamente per qualche motivo. Non sto incollando il codice perché è troppo grande. Altre versioni precedenti di questo EA stanno lavorando bene nel tester.

MT5 build 1150

Dopo la linea nel registro: Qualità della storia analizzata 100%

:Core1 Disconnesso - perché?

 
Igor Kuzminets:

Non riesco a capire perché l'EA non parte nel tester; apre la finestra di test in modalità visualizzazione e poi la chiude. Sto incollando uno screenshot del messaggio nel diario. L'EA compila senza errori, ma viene scaricato immediatamente per qualche motivo. Non sto incollando il codice perché è troppo grande. Altre versioni precedenti di questo EA stanno lavorando bene nel tester.

MT5 build 1150

Dopo la linea nel registro: Qualità della storia analizzata 100%

:Core1 Disconnesso - perché?

Cosa dice il log del tester?
 

La finestra del tester si apre e si chiude immediatamente 0,5 secondi dopo, quindi non è possibile vedere il log del tester. Test su EURUSD, altri EAs su questo periodo e strumento funzionano bene. Ora sto cercando di commentare il codice in grandi pezzi, solo per esclusione, ma il compilatore non vede alcun errore nel codice.

 
Igor Kuzminets:

La finestra del tester si apre e si chiude immediatamente 0,5 secondi dopo, quindi non è possibile vedere il log del tester. Test su EURUSD, altri EAs su questo periodo e strumento funzionano bene. Ora sto cercando di commentare il codice in grandi pezzi, solo per esclusione, ma il compilatore non vede alcun errore nel codice.

Il percorso del log del tester è approssimativamente: ..\AppData\Roaming\MetaQuotes\Tester\D0E8209F77C8CF37AD8BF550E51FF075\Agent-127.0.0.1-3000\Logs
 
MT4 non funziona per caricare un set di caratteri da *.set in Market Watch?
 

Funziona se il .set si trova nella cartella \symbolsets, anche se può essere salvato in qualsiasi cartella

Caratteristica speciale: l'ordine originale non viene ripristinato se si cambia più volte

 
Quandosi copiano le transazioni, queste vengono aperte con un volume minimo, non in proporzione al deposito. Come si può correggere la situazione?
 
uekzq:
Quando sicopiano i trade si aprono con un volume minimo, non proporzionale al deposito. Come correggere la situazione?
  1. Leggete le raccomandazioni delle regole, in particolare: "... il conto di trading dovrebbe essere aperto sullo stesso server di trading del fornitore di segnali...".
  2. Guarda il log del terminale - e vedi quale rapporto di copia è impostato dal sistema...